Nate Bargatze is ready to cut a big check.
If the Emmy award winners in 2025 manage to deliver brief speeches, that would be great. The host of the September 14 ceremony on CBS has actually shared his strategy for quickening the on-stage acknowledgements and ensuring this year’s event stays within a three-hour timeframe.
On the September 10th episode of “Jimmy Kimmel Live”, Nate who was hosting for the first time, shared that each person would have 45 seconds to express their thanks. He explained, “I’ve decided to kick things off by donating $100,000 to the Boys & Girls Club. Here’s the deal: everyone will get their 45 seconds. If someone takes longer than that, we’ll deduct $1,000 for every second they go over. It might be tough. On the flip side, if you finish early, we’ll add $1,000 back on so you can contribute it.
He went on to say that the cost might be substantial, things could get quite unpredictable, and everyone would need to contribute their time generously. If everybody donates, it would amount to a significant sum of money. Those who invest for a longer period, that’s acceptable. Bring the total down to around $10,000, if you can.
To further motivate, the comedian, Nate Bargatze (who you might call a friend), intends to involve children from a charitable organization during the event. Undeniably, he’s showing his readiness to back up his words with actions, as evident by his age of 46 years.
Nate jokingly remarked, “They’re going to show up and you need to meet their gaze.” He emphasized, “It’s genuine, truly. That’s why we included the extra part, because I figured everyone would think it was a prank if we just removed it. Honestly, I’m putting my money where my mouth is.
He also mentioned, “I didn’t prefer that they pay for it at the very last moment; instead, I made it clear, ‘This is exactly what they are purchasing.’
Nate isn’t making any predictions about the outcome either.
He explained to Jimmy Kimmel that the decision about how much or how little they will give rests with that room. He said it’s beyond his control, apologizing as he had a TV show to run through. Jimmy only has 45 seconds. Since he lost several times before, it will be intriguing.
